地面机动目标的红外诱饵欺骗技术研究

摘要
针对地面机动目标的红外特性及作战环境,分析了红外诱饵的欺骗作用机理,探讨了现有技术中面源诱饵难以形成、红外辐射持续时间短、长波辐射较弱等制约地面车载诱饵发展的 3个主要问题,提出了相应的解决方案。
Abstract
Based on the infrared characteristics of land-based maneuvering targets and the battlefield environment, the infrared decoy deception mechanism is analyzed. Three main problems have been proposed in the article. The decoy agent can not form a large obstacle area. The infrared radiation can not last for a long time and the long-wave radiation is not strong enough. Combining with the existing infrared decoy technology at home and abroad, the article finally proposes the idea of decoy ammunition agent design scheme.
